数据库1核1g速度怎么样?

服务器

深入解析单核1GB内存数据库的性能与优化策略

在信息技术飞速发展的今天,数据库作为存储和管理数据的核心组件,其性能对于系统的整体效能有着至关重要的影响。其中,数据库的配置,特别是内存容量,直接决定了其处理数据的速度和响应能力。这里将重点探讨单核1GB内存数据库的运行情况,并从多个维度进行深入分析。

首先,我们需要明确一点,单核1GB内存的数据库在资源分配上相对有限。由于单核心意味着只有一个处理器可以同时执行任务,而1GB内存意味着在并发访问量不大的情况下,数据库能快速存取的数据总量受限。这意味着在高并发场景下,可能会出现性能瓶颈,因为内存不足以支撑大量并发请求的快速处理。

然而,这并不意味着这样的配置无法胜任轻量级应用。对于小型企业或个人开发者,处理的数据规模较小,查询需求简单,单核1GB的数据库可能足以满足日常需求。例如,一个简单的博客系统或者小型电商网站,其数据量不大,且大部分查询为读取操作,这种配置可能绰绰有余。

然而,当涉及到复杂的查询、大数据分析或者实时更新时,单核1GB的数据库就显得力不从心了。频繁的数据读写、复杂的索引操作和多表关联查询都会消耗大量内存,导致响应速度下降。此外,由于数据量的增长,单核数据库的扩展性也会受限,可能需要频繁升级硬件以适应业务需求。

为了提高单核1GB数据库的性能,优化策略至关重要。首先,合理设计数据库结构,如使用合适的索引,可以显著提升查询效率。其次,对数据进行定期的清理和归档,减少活跃数据的内存占用。此外,使用缓存技术,如Redis或Memcached,可以缓解数据库压力,提高读取速度。最后,通过编程优化,如减少不必要的查询和批量处理,也能有效提升数据库性能。

总的来说,单核1GB内存的数据库在特定的应用场景下可以提供足够的性能,但在面对大规模数据和复杂业务需求时,其局限性逐渐显现。因此,企业在选择数据库配置时,应充分评估自身的业务需求,权衡成本与性能,确保数据库能够高效稳定地支持业务发展。对于性能要求较高的场景,升级到更大的内存容量或者采用分布式数据库可能是更明智的选择。

未经允许不得转载:CDNK博客 » 数据库1核1g速度怎么样?